Reviews play a crucial role in shaping our decisions when it comes to choosing what books to read or documentaries to watch. Websites like Goodreads and IMDb have become go-to platforms for individuals to discover new content and read what others have to say about it. Reading reviews provides valuable insights into the quality, themes, and overall impact of a piece of media, helping consumers make informed choices. Statistics also play a significant role in analyzing the popularity and reception of books and documentaries. Platforms like Amazon and Netflix gather data on sales, ratings, and views, which can offer a quantitative perspective on the success of a particular title. By looking at statistics, researchers and enthusiasts can identify trends, preferences, and patterns in audience behavior, which can inform future content creation and marketing strategies. Moreover, communication tools have revolutionized the way we engage with media content. Social media platforms like Twitter, Facebook, and Instagram allow individuals to share their thoughts, reactions, and recommendations with a global audience. Through discussions, debates, and collaborations, social media users can create a vibrant community around books and documentaries, fostering a sense of camaraderie and shared enthusiasm.
